So basically, I had a basic idea for this song, but changed it a couple times today before finally making a final decision. I then wrote these lyrics in 20 minutes, a record time! They just all came to me. The story is about a girl who finds a 'place' where she can go and see her future (The Cemetary of Tears). She becomes so obsessed with it she can't do anything else. Every night she goes back to it and at the break of dawn she leaves. Until one night, she sees herself being killed. Now the Cemetary of Tears is not real, but is more or less a realm that she drifts into while she is asleep. The next night, she is murdered. This other realsm predicted her entire future for her so everything was perfect, but she ignored this vision, and it came true.
